Technical Sheet
-
Estimated time: 20 minutes
-
Difficulty: ⭐
-
Servings: 2 people
Ingredients
-
200g spaghetti (durum wheat or whole wheat)
-
400g crushed or chopped fresh tomato
-
6-8 anchovy fillets in olive oil
-
60g grated Parmesan or Grana Padano cheese
-
1 clove garlic
-
A bunch of fresh basil
-
Extra virgin olive oil
-
Seasoning: Bonsalt 0% and a pinch of sugar (to balance the acidity of the tomato).
Professional Step-by-Step Preparation
-
Pasta doneness: Cook the spaghetti in plenty of water with a pinch of Bonsalt . Cook until al dente. Reserve some of the cooking water before draining.
-
Flavor base: In a large skillet, heat a drizzle of olive oil and brown the sliced garlic clove. Add the anchovies and stir over medium heat until you see them practically dissolve into the oil.
-
Tomato sauce: Pour the crushed tomato over the anchovies. Add a pinch of sugar to balance the acidity and season with Bonsalt . Let it simmer over low heat for 10-12 minutes until the sauce thickens.
-
Combining: Add the spaghetti directly to the skillet with the sauce. Add a couple of tablespoons of the reserved cooking water so the sauce emulsifies and coats the pasta perfectly.
-
Final aromas: Remove from the heat and add the fresh basil leaves torn by hand (so they do not oxidize) and half of the grated cheese. Stir well.
-
Serving: Serve immediately, topping the dish with the remaining cheese and a few whole basil leaves for garnish.
